How much do remote python front end developer jobs pay per hour?

As of May 31,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ote python front end developer in the United States is $58.62,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$48.32 and $66.59 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

How do Remote Python Front End Developers typically collaborate with team members across different locations and time zones?

Remote Python Front End Developers often work closely with designers, backend engineers, and project managers through digital collaboration tools such as Slack, Jira, and GitHub. Since teams may be distributed globally, regular stand-up meetings, asynchronous code reviews, and clear documentation are essential to maintain alignment and productivity. Effective communication and proactive status updates help ensure that project goals are met despite varying work hours. Adapting to these collaborative practices is key to succeeding in a remote front end development role.

What are Remote Python Front End Developers?

Remote Python Front End Developers are professionals who specialize in building the user interface of web applications using Python-based web frameworks and front-end technologies, while working from a remote location. They combine their knowledge of Python (often using frameworks like Django or Flask for back-end integration) with front-end languages such as HTML, CSS, and JavaScript to create responsive and interactive user experiences. These developers collaborate with teams online and use tools for version control, testing, and deployment to ensure seamless web application performance. Working remotely allows them to contribute to projects from anywhere, offering flexibility and access to global opportunities.
